Croatian coach, Boris Pučić, has written off Super Eagles’ skipper John Obi Mikel and Alex Iwobi ahead of Russia 2018 FIFA World Cup.
Pucic, who has close links to Football College, Abuja, revealed that Chelsea’s Victor Moses is the only star player on the Nigeria team, and the present squad cannot be compared to the USA 1994 and 1998 teams.
”They are not very pleased with the fact that they have drawn Croatia, but who would be. However, they are hoping that Nigeria will win, but I’m just waiting for a day to celebrate, I think we have no reason to be afraid,” said Pučić to sportske.jutarnji.hr.
”Obi Mikel plays in China, Moses has been injured for some time and has just returned to Chelsea’s first team, while others are all in some side-tiers.
”Iheanacho and Musa are in reserve in Leicester, Iwobi for Arsenal plays a bit more, but Nigeria is not the shadow of the national team that they once called ‘African Brazil.
”Simply, there is no star player besides Moses in Chelsea and the team is not close to what we remember from the World Cup in the United States or France that played really well.”
